Are Unsafe Trees Threatening Your Safety?

How can someone evaluate if dangerous trees constitute a safety hazard? Assessing the condition of trees is critical in pinpointing potential dangers. Factors such as visible decay, dead branches, and leaning trunks can signal instability. Moreover, the proximity of trees to constructions, walkways, or power lines elevates the risk of damage during storms or severe weather. Soil erosion around the root system may also compromise a tree's stability, making it more likely to falling.

Periodic inspections by licensed arborists can provide a detailed evaluation of tree health and safety. They can identify signs of disease or infestation that may not be instantly visible. Moreover, analyzing the surrounding landscape and its impact on tree stability is vital. Property owners should stay alert and diligent in observing their trees to guarantee a safe environment for themselves and their neighbors, thereby stopping potential hazards before they develop.

Dead or Dying Trees

As trees start showing symptoms of decline, including significant leaf loss or extensive dead branches, it becomes essential for property owners to examine their condition. Dead or dying trees pose risks, including potential dangers to nearby structures and individuals. Discoloration of leaves, premature leaf drop, and the presence of fungi or mushrooms at the base can indicate decay. Furthermore, a tree with detailed resource a hollow trunk or large cracks may signify internal damage. Property owners should contact tree care professionals to evaluate the tree's health and determine the best course of action. Timely removal can prevent further damage to the landscape and ensure safety, making it essential to recognize these warning signs immediately.

Damaged Root Systems

The stability of a tree largely depends on a strong root system, and signs of instability can indicate an urgent need for removal. Identifying visible cracks in the soil around a tree's base or exposed roots can indicate that the root system is compromised. In addition, trees that lean noticeably to one side may have weakened roots incapable of supporting their weight, placing nearby structures at risk. If a tree experiences excessive or sudden shedding of leaves, it may signal root stress, potentially leading to its failure. Moreover, fungal growth at the base can signal decay within the root system. Homeowners should regularly inspect their trees and consult professionals if they spot any of these warning signs to protect safety and preserve the landscape.

What to Expect During Tree Removal?

As property owners prepare for tree removal, they can expect a well-coordinated process that prioritizes efficiency and safety. To begin, a professional team will assess the tree's condition and surrounding environment, establishing the best approach for removal. This examination includes identifying potential hazards, such as electrical lines or adjacent buildings.

Once the strategy is set, the team will ensure the area is secure, ensuring that bystanders and pets are at a safe distance. The removal process normally begins with pruning limbs to decrease the load and mitigate risks.

Following this, the trunk is removed in sections, allowing for careful and secure descent. The team will employ specialized equipment, such as chainsaws and ropes, to control the process successfully.

After the tree has been removed, they will clean up debris, guaranteeing the area is left tidy. Homeowners can look forward to professionalism and expertise throughout the complete process, improving their landscape safely.

Essential Information About Stump Grinding

Stump grinding constitutes a vital component in the tree removal process, often neglected by homeowners. This process involves employing specialized machinery to grind down the remaining tree stump to below ground level, which minimizes the visual impact on the landscape. Homeowners should realize that stump grinding is not merely aesthetic; it also helps prevent potential hazards, such as tripping or damage to lawn equipment. Furthermore, removing the stump minimizes the risk of pest infestations, as decaying wood can attract insects like termites or carpenter ants.

This grinding process usually entails a professional operator who will assess the stump's size and location before proceeding. The resulting wood chips can be repurposed as mulch or removed from the property. It's vital to hire seasoned experts, as inadequate grinding can result in soil erosion or damage to surrounding plants. Homeowners should consider stump grinding an important part of their tree removal plan.

Stopping Bug Infestations

What concealed risks may exist underneath an eyesore tree stump? Tree stumps may act as nesting sites for pests like termites, ants, and beetles. These creatures are not simply unpleasant but may also introduce considerable risks to local vegetation and even the structural soundness of nearby properties. As the stump breaks down, it lures these bugs, creating infestations that may transfer to robust trees and plants. Stump grinding effectively eliminates this risk by removing the stump and its root system, thereby disrupting the habitat for pests. Furthermore, it encourages a more vibrant landscape, enabling new plants to flourish without interference from rotting wood. Investing in stump grinding is a proactive step in maintaining a pest-free and vibrant outdoor space.

How Can I Prepare My Yard for Tree Removal?

To prepare for tree removal, you should remove obstacles from the area, identify the tree's perimeter, evaluate surrounding structures, and speak with neighboring residents. Guaranteeing safety and access is essential for an smooth removal process.

Are Tree Removal Costs Covered by Homeowners Insurance?

Tree removal may be covered by homeowners insurance, based on the circumstances. Typical policies cover storm damage or hazards, but not preventative tree removals. Homeowners should check their policy details or speak with their insurance agent for more information.

Can New Trees Be Planted After Stump Grinding?

Absolutely, you can plant new trees after stump grinding. Nevertheless, it's recommended to wait 2-3 weeks for the area to settle and ensure that any leftover roots won't hinder new growth.

What Happens with the Soil Following Stump Grinding?

Following stump grinding, the soil may become loose and enriched with natural nutrients from decomposing wood. Nonetheless, it may require additional modification for best nutrient balance to promote new plant growth successfully in the area.

What Is the Typical Duration of Tree Removal?

Tree removal usually takes between a few hours and a full day, depending on variables such as tree size, location, and complexity. Professional arborists examine these variables to provide an accurate estimate for the entire process.
